Be Impressed, Free from Stress Non-Invasive Blood Pressure measurement with linear i nflation technology iNIBP technology measures NIBP while inflating the cuff. Conventional technology inflates the cuff to a fixed pressure then deflates the cuff to measure. In a clinical study of 323 measurements in the OR, iNIBP measured NIBP in an average of 13 s but the conventional step down method took an average of 33s. Conventional step down method Linear Inflation Time iNIBP is about 20 seconds faster. The conventional step-down method sets the maximum cuff pressure to over the previously measured systolic pressure. iNIBP intelligent technology inflates the cuff to just above the systolic pressure so it is faster and gentler to patients. iNIBP accuracy meets ISO 81060-2 and ANSI/AAMI SP10 standards. 87 patients and 261 measurements were used for the clinical investigation. If an artifact prevents pressure measurement during inflation, iNIBP automatically switches to conventional step down method to ensure a successful pressure measurement. Availability iNIBP technology is only available on Nihon Kohden patient monitors with the iNIBP label (BSM-1700 series) and YAWARA CUFF 2 NIBP cuffs. If a different cuff is used, the linear inflation measurement may change to step down measurement more frequently. The inflation bags of infant and child cuffs are too small for the linear inflation method so it is more likely to switch to step down measurement. Enhanced Patient Comfort Yawara(kai) means "soft touch" Conventional cuffs can cause bruising when the skin gets pinched between folds in the cuff. YAWARA CUFF 2 uses a smooth soft cloth and buffer sheet to prevent skin pinching. YAWARA CUFF 2 uses a kink-free tube which doesn't block the air flow even if the tube is bent at a 180° angle. This prevents harmful incidents related to kinking. YAWARA CUFF 2 is the only cuff with this extra margin of safety. Incorrect cuff size gives inaccurate pressure reading.
